Fischer & Mieg Pirkenhammer Porcelain 'Imari' Pattern Round Handled Platter Impressed Marks of F&M and the number 2 An exquisite piece of Fischer & Mieg Pirkenhammer porcelain, this 'Imari' pattern twin handled circular platter is a true work of art. Adorned with gilt enamel, vibrant hand painting and enameling, it radiates elegance and sophistication. Measuring a generous 15 inches wide from handle to handle and standing at 14.25 inches high, this platter boasts an impressive size that makes it a captivating centerpiece for any display or table setting. The platter features impressed marks of authenticity, bearing the signature of the prestigious F&M signature and the number 2, further confirming its genuine origin and quality.
